At the risk of becoming the marketing arm of DoubleButter, I heard yesterday they were accepted into the Haute Green show this year, which is moving across the river to the DWR showroom downtown. They are bringing the Crow side table, which, while not my favorite piece of theirs, uses some cleverly re-purposed materials that makes it a perfect fit for the show. And they've found a way to pack a couple more into the structure of the shipping crate, which is an idea that has always been kind of intriguing. For example, the Max Longin Float bed also uses some of its parts as elements of its shipping crate.
